That's why you have to reboot after installing Vanguard. ![]() If Vanguard's driver isn't started with Windows, Valorant won't trust your PC, and you won't be able to play. It doesn't collect data about your PC or send anything to Riot: It looks at other drivers and blocks them from running if it detects that they have a known vulnerability that could be used to compromise the anti-cheat client. (Vanguard blocks fewer programs as of an update in May, and in the future may prevent Valorant from running instead of blocking the offending software.) The kernel-mode driver is the client's bodyguard, basically.
